WebAug 29, 1998 · Summary points. The 1848 act identified all the major public health issues of the time and established a structure for dealing with them. Public health became the responsibility of local people. Web1964: Surgeon General’s Report on Smoking and Health published; President Johnson signs the Medicare/Medicaid Act. 1965: APHA publishes the first Public Health Law Manual. 1970: Congress establishes the Environmental Protection Agency; the Occupational Safety and Health Administration; and the National Institute for Occupational Safety and ... The Public Health Service Act is a United States federal law enacted in 1944. [2] The full act is codified in Title 42 of the United States Code (The Public Health and Welfare), Chapter 6A ( Public Health Service ). new world nyhart\u0027s anchorage
